How they compare
Panama currently reports 12.75 kt against 10.76 kt in Costa Rica, a difference of 1.99 kt.
That makes Panama's figure about 1.2 times Costa Rica's.
The two have swapped places 2 times across 34 shared years of data; in 1990 it was Panama ahead.
Costa Rica ranks 64th and Panama ranks 60th of 133 countries.
Across the 4 decades both report, Costa Rica averaged higher in 2 and Panama in 2.
Head to head by decade
| Decade | Costa Rica | Panama |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 0.3062 kt | 2.03 kt | 1.72 kt | Panama |
| 2000s | 4.72 kt | 3.45 kt | 1.27 kt | Costa Rica |
| 2010s | 9.1 kt | 8.78 kt | 0.3193 kt | Costa Rica |
| 2020s | 10.68 kt | 12.57 kt | 1.88 kt | Panama |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
